Second warning issued in Riyadh within hours amid attacks
Riyadh, Sept. 19 -- Saudi Arabia's Civil Defence on Saturday morning, September 19, issued a second warning over potential danger in Riyadh and Al-Kharj Governorate through the National Early Warning Platform for Emergencies. The danger in those areas later passed.
The authority had earlier issued a warning for Riyadh and Al-Kharj Governorate, before issuing the latest alert.
In a statement on X, the Civil Defence urged residents to follow official safety instructions and avoid gatherings and filming.
For their safety, residents were urged to remain calm, follow official Civil Defence instructions and move to a safe place. They were also advised to avoid gatherings and filming.
